Do not edit below this line.=-_ ## Source: amazon-inspector (826e81131e7b2a296324d469c10f1e44d5b33683703c8a2e0f101a8674c1cfcf) The package impersonates the Tink open-banking SDK (name @tink/tink-link-core, description 'Enterprise-grade client core for open banking', homepage github.com/tink-link/core) but its actual behavior is host reconnaissance and DNS exfiltration. The package.json install script runs `node index.js`, and both the install entry and main entry load lib/core.js, which reads os.userInfo().username, os.hostname(), and process.cwd(), joins them with a prefix and a hardcoded domain as DNS labels, and issues a dns.resolve4() lookup. The destination hostname and module/API names are reconstructed at runtime from hex byte arrays via Buffer.from(...).toString('utf8') in lib/b02e30.js and lib/6ad264.js — the decoded domain is oob.algamil7x.xyz and the label prefix is tinkcore. Module names 'os','dns','process' and API names 'userInfo','hostname','cwd','resolve4' are loaded via module.constructor._load with hex-decoded strings to hide them from static review. DNS-based egress bypasses HTTP proxy and firewall controls. The beacon fires automatically on `npm install` (via the install lifecycle script) and again on `require()` of the package, giving the attacker installer username, hostname, and current working directory for every affected environment.
